Laura L. Patterson

Age 52, of West Alexandria, passed away Thursday, July 19, 2018.

She was born October 19, 1965 to her parents Fred and Mary Croy.

Laura was preceded in death by her mother-in-law, Mary Lake.

She is survived by her husband of 32 years, Charles; children, Jason Patterson, Joey (Deann) Patterson, Venessa Patterson, Miranda (John) Smedley, and Lenden (Nicki) Patterson; sister, Dorene (Alan) Thompson; brother, David (Threasa) Croy; 17 grandchildren; and 1 great-grandchild.

Laura loved spending time outdoors doing things such as hiking, fishing, and camping.  She enjoyed gardening, flowers, and adult coloring.  During her breaks at work, she would often visit with her residents at Ohio Living, and loved the people she worked with.

A Visitation will take place Saturday, August 4, 2018 from 10AM to 12PM at Eaton First Church of the Nazarene, 201 E. Lexington Road, Eaton 45320.  A Memorial Service will begin at 12PM with Pastor Jim High officiating.
